Output bb0ef04e942d91468b946873c4bab5627f40d57e3efc5ee1a0a884f42d485152:1

value
510699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d88f45df4afb7fc97d12d3bab88541a380213d9 OP_EQUAL
address
3D8nTHtvcTBNUSv6LYSz875Hibp8n7zFjG
transaction
bb0ef04e942d91468b946873c4bab5627f40d57e3efc5ee1a0a884f42d485152
confirmations
248151
spent
true